I rebuilt my 94 Ranger 4.0L last September, 2018. Since then I have put less than 2000 miles on it. Recently I checked the plugs and found the plug in #5 cylinder looked pretty bad.

Yes, looks like ash deposits from oil
Good look here at spark plug tips: https://www.boschautoparts.com/docum...2-1dadd0d5def6
The threads look bad as well, you have a valve cover leak above #5 spark plug hole?
You could have had a big wack of assembly lube in/at #5 intake

Thanks RonD. I installed brand new heads, and didn't noticed an excess of assembly lube. I did have a lot of oil in the cylinders when I assembled. Also I noticed all the plugs had loosened to where I barely had to budge to get them out. So I must not have tightened them enough, which could explain the oil on the threads. One plug, either 5 or 6, the spark plug wire had come off, which had been causing a miss. I replaced all the plugs with the recommended platinum tipped plug, and tightened them adequately this time. I suppose I'll drive another few hundred miles and then check #5 again.
